Ok, I agree that the game can be extended for a number of hours, but the main story line is so muddied by side quests.
There is the one, Goonies-esque side quest where you go to the treasure island. I loved the side quest, but it had no relation to the main game. I'm just doing this because I'm a hero and I can? Even owning homes and marrying doesn't really tie into the game that well. You are a hero, and you need to have a domestic life while you are away?
I know that this is standard RPG fare, but so many RPGs have epic story lines and the side quests are there for additional playtime. Arguing that game's length includes side quests isn't really fair to other RPGs.

I would warn anyone looking to buy Fable II to wait until they patch it up. There are some brutal game ruining bugs. I've had 2 games ruined (~30 hours of gameplay down the tubes).
There's a lot of great things that Fable II really nailed this time around, and overall I like the game a lot. But unfortunately, there are a *lot* of glitches, and some of the ones involving your family really ruin a lot of that experience for you, which is a terrible shame.
